    50% Don’t Take Their Meds: Inside Elfie’s Mission to Fix Adherence

    Medication non-adherence costs Europe €125 billion and over 200,000 premature deaths every year — yet roughly half of patients still don’t take their treatment as prescribed. In this episode of Rethinking Health, Grace McNamara sits down with Emilie Cristini, one of Elfie’s first employees and now head of global pharma partnerships and country operations. Emilie shares how Elfie grew from a single hypertension product in Brazil into a holistic, multi-morbidity health platform now operating across Southeast Asia, Africa, Turkey, Latin America and beyond. The conversation covers why non-adherence is a system failure rather than a motivation problem, the published evidence behind Elfie (including a 37% adherence increase in the Engaged study), an upcoming RCT with the European Society of Cardiology, and how AI features like face-scan blood-pressure measurement, body scans and nutrition analysis are reshaping the patient journey. They also dig into the realities of clinician trust, data privacy, the EU AI Act, and why it still takes 17 years for best practice to become standard practice in healthcare — plus a look ahead at Elfie Care for doctors, WhatsApp-based health AI, and new Ministry of Health partnerships.     Scaling the Doctor: Inside Elfie’s First Government MOU for AI-Powered Care

    What does it take for a government to put its name behind an AI health platform? In this episode of Elfie Voices: Rethinking Health, Grace McNamara sits down with Elfie co-founders Ofir and JF to unpack a landmark moment: their first Memorandum of Understanding with a government to deploy ELFIECARE across doctors and hospitals — free of charge. After five years proving the hardest thing in digital health — patient engagement — Elfie’s data surfaced a defining insight: the doctor is the single biggest agent of change, with doctor-referred patients showing double the adherence and double the impact. That insight reshaped the company’s next move: empowering clinicians with conversational AI that plugs into existing workflows on WhatsApp, never replacing the systems already in place. Ofir and JF lay out the economics that make Ministries of Health pay attention — exploding chronic-disease costs, the urgent need to “scale the doctor,” and a model that delivers controlled, compliant AI with local data residency in markets the big cloud providers don’t even serve. They explain why Elfie’s moat is the difficult path most vendors avoid: free deployment, ministry authorization, demonstrated medical impact, and a real-time epidemiologic data layer that finally lets governments and pharma see whether their spending actually works.
